H-1B sponsorship in Ohio
210,176 H-1B Labor Condition Applications were filed for worksites in Ohio across the covered fiscal years. State concentration ratios and top sponsors below.

Top sponsoring employers
Highest-volume H-1B sponsors with worksites in Ohio. Share % is each sponsor’s portion of the state’s total filings.
| # | Employer | Filings | Share |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| TATA CONSULTANCY SERVICES LIMITED | 7,331 | 5.4% |
| 2 | INFOSYS LIMITED | 4,061 | 3.0% |
| 3 | COGNIZANT TECHNOLOGY SOLUTIONS US CORP | 4,030 | 3.0% |
| 4 | JPMorgan Chase & Co. | 3,411 | 2.5% |
| 5 | The Ohio State University | 3,186 | 2.4% |
| 6 | WIPRO LIMITED | 2,780 | 2.1% |
| 7 | Accenture LLP | 2,479 | 1.8% |
| 8 | CAPGEMINI AMERICA INC | 2,098 | 1.6% |
| 9 | Case Western Reserve University | 1,689 | 1.3% |
| 10 | Deloitte Consulting LLP | 1,617 | 1.2% |
| 11 | IBM India Private Limited | 1,598 | 1.2% |
| 12 | Ernst & Young U.S. LLP | 1,589 | 1.2% |
| 13 | LARSEN & TOUBRO INFOTECH LIMITED | 1,515 | 1.1% |
| 14 | Cincinnati Children's Hospital Medical Center | 1,325 | 1.0% |
| 15 | IBM Corporation | 1,172 | 0.9% |

Top occupations sponsored
SOC codes filed most for worksites in Ohio.
| # | SOC | Title | Filings |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| 15-1252 | Software Developers | 62,741 |
| 2 | 15-1211 | Computer Systems Analysts | 21,549 |
| 3 | 15-1299 | Computer Occupations, All Other | 14,075 |
| 4 | 15-1251 | Computer Programmers | 12,930 |
| 5 | 15-1253 | Software Quality Assurance Analysts and Testers | 10,123 |
| 6 | 15-2051 | Data Scientists | 6,161 |
| 7 | 13-1111 | Management Analysts | 5,680 |
| 8 | 17-2141 | Mechanical Engineers | 5,524 |
| 9 | 29-1229 | Physicians, All Other | 4,553 |
| 10 | 17-2112 | Industrial Engineers | 2,869 |

Filings by fiscal year
Ohio H-1B filing volume year over year — a hiring-demand signal for the state, not headcount.
| Period | Value |
|---|---|
| FY2010 | 7,732 |
| FY2011 | 8,583 |
| FY2012 | 10,428 |
| FY2013 | 11,642 |
| FY2014 | 13,515 |
| FY2015 | 16,066 |
| FY2016 | 16,344 |
| FY2017 | 15,466 |
| FY2018 | 15,959 |
| FY2019 | 1,994 |
| FY2020 | 14,006 |
| FY2021 | 18,778 |
| FY2022 | 13,179 |
| FY2023 | 13,640 |
| FY2024 | 11,927 |
| FY2025 | 12,084 |
| FY2026 | 8,833 |
